php 相关函数
strtr , strstr 与strchr
strtr() 函数转换字符串中特定的字符。 strtr(string,from,to)
string 必需。规定要转换的字符串。 from 必需(除非使用数组)。规定要改变的字符。 to 必需(除非使用数组)。规定要改变为的字符。 array 必需(除非使用 from 和 to)。数组,其中的键名是更改的原始字符,键值是更改的目标字符。
strtr("Hilla Warld","ia","eo"); Hello World
array("Hello" => "Hi", "world" => "earth");
strtr("Hello world",$arr); "Hi earth
strchr
搜索 "Shanghai" 在字符串中的位置,并返回从该位置到字符串结尾的所有字符:
strchr("I Shanghai love Shanghai!","Shanghai"); 同strstr Shanghai love Shanghai!
strrchr("I Shanghai love Shanghai!","Shanghai"); Shanghai!
strstr
查找 "Shanghai" 在字符串中的第一次出现,并返回字符串的剩余部分:
strstr("I love Shanghai!","Shanghai"); Shanghai!
与strchr不同的是strstr有第三个参数
strstr('abc.txt', '.', true); //如果有第三个参数则会返回abc;即返回所查找字符之前的字符串

浙公网安备 33010602011771号